302 BMW cars for sale in Chesham

Main listing image - BMW X1

BMW X1sDrive 20i xLine 5dr Step Auto

2019
58,000 miles
Petrol

£16,795

or £291 mo
32 miles away

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£290.79, Customer Deposit: £2,519.00, Total Deposit: £2,519.25, Optional Final Payment: £6,053.05, Total Charge For Credit: £5,444.43, Total Amount Payable: £22,239.43, Representative APR: 13.80%, Interest Rate (Fixed): 13.80%, Excess Mileage Charge: 4.89ppm, Mileage Per Annum: 10,000

BMW X3xDrive20 M Sport 5dr Step Auto

2024
6,461 miles
Hybrid

£52,872

or £754 mo
34 miles away

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£753.20, Customer Deposit: £7,930.00, Total Deposit: £7,930.80, Optional Final Payment: £22,558.84, Total Charge For Credit: £13,018.04, Total Amount Payable: £65,890.04,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 14.80ppm, Mileage Per Annum: 10,000

181-198 of 302 vehicles